3 Ways to Not Take Yourself Too Seriously
Introduction:
In today’s fast-paced and competitive world, it’s easy to feel the pressure of needing to be perfect and take ourselves too seriously. However, learning how to lighten up and not take ourselves too seriously can have a significant positive impact on our mental health, relationships, and overall well-being. In this article, we will explore three powerful ways to help you not take yourself too seriously and enjoy life more.
1. Embrace humor:
One of the best ways to stop taking ourselves too seriously is by infusing our lives with humor. Look for opportunities to laugh at funny things, share a joke or funny story, or even poke fun at yourself. Laughter has numerous proven health benefits, such as reducing stress and boosting mood. By incorporating humor into our daily lives, we can build resilience and foster a more relaxed outlook on life.
2. Practice self-compassion:
We’re often our own harshest critic – quick to point out our mistakes and inadequacies while ignoring our many strengths and accomplishments. To stop taking ourselves so seriously, we need to develop self-compassion. Be kinder to yourself when things don’t go as planned or when you make mistakes, reminding yourself that nobody is perfect and that it’s okay to be a work in progress. By treating ourselves with kindness, we can learn to accept our imperfections and stop placing unrealistic expectations on ourselves.
3. Seek perspective:
When we take ourselves too seriously, we tend to overestimate the importance of our problems or missteps, which only adds unnecessary stress and anxiety to our lives. To combat this tendency, actively seek perspective by reminding yourself of the bigger picture. Ask yourself if your current worries will matter in a week, month or year from now, and consider whether there are other people in your life who might be dealing with more significant challenges. This perspective-shift can help us put our issues into context and lead to a more balanced outlook on life.
